National Account Manager

Responsible for managing Kenvue’s portfolio of brands managing our Value Channels accounts, including Aldi, Costo and Big W. This includes the day to day management of account relationships, effective promotional planning spend management and leading category review processes to deliver physical availability to the end consumer and achieve set financial targets.

This position reports into the National Business Manager and is based in Sydney, Australia.

What You Will Do

The National Account Manager plays a critical part in achieving Kenvue’s purpose by partnering with the customer to build brands and drive revenue growth through effective customer strategies for the end consumer. The National Account Manager is responsible for:

  • Demonstrating strong commercial acumen and customer centricity with our customers to develop tailored offerings to Value Channel shoppers that ensures the physical availability of our brands in the market

  • Developing, implementing and executing robust annual Joint Business Plans and Category Reviews that ensure ongoing financial success and mutual growth for both the customer and Kenvue

  • Working collaboratively across our organisation to develop compelling category and shopper insights that result in strategic plans that accelerate growth

Key Responsibilities

  • Cultivating partnerships that develop and maintain strong relationships with customers and internal stakeholders

  • Develop a more strategic approach to account management through the implementation and ongoing servicing of forecasting and ROI tracking, including providing accurate stock forecasts to ensure stable supply

  • Continuous evaluation of sales performance and identification of opportunities to grow sales and improve profitability

  • Develop and implement joint business plans with the customer by forming mutually beneficial strategies to achieve sustainable growth for our brands

  • Develop and implement category level joint business plans for your portfolio, including annual promotional and activation calendars

  • Lead the category review process to ensure improved visibility and physical availability of your product range

  • Manage trade spend budgets within customer investment guard rails to deliver profitable growth

  • Ensure the field team is adequately briefed to support national activity to maximise sales results

  • Negotiate mutually beneficial strategies to drive category and sales growth for both businesses

  • Work collaboratively with internal category and marketing teams to shape strategic plans

  • Be a key contributor to the broader Sales Team through sharing best practice initiatives in all internal forums
